Robert P. Fite (1920-2000) –  Fite was born in Brown County, Ohio and moved to Piqua in 1947

after graduating from the Ohio State University Law School.  In July of 1949, he became associated

 with the firm of Berry, McCulloch and Felger.  Fite was the third generation of his family to practice

law.  He served in World War II as an infantry company commander in the Pacific Theater.  Fite was

very active in government activities including serving on the boards of the YMCA, Red Cross,

Edison State College, the Piqua Memorial Hospital, the Piqua Board of Education, the Piqua Rotary

Club and a founding member of the Junior Chamber of Commerce and the Young Republicans Club.

 Fite was also one of the owners of the Cincinnati Bengals pro-football team.
